Orchestra of the Age of Enlightenment’s Baroque Reinventions
Thursday 14 October 2010, 7.30pm

Proving that imitation is sometimes the sincerest form of flattery, this concert showcases several original pieces by Gottlieb Muffat re-worked by Handel and an arrangement by Bach of Pergolesi’s ‘Stabat Mater’.

REMIX
Thursday 14 – Saturday 16 October 2010
Kings Place

The London Sinfonietta and the Orchestra of the Age of Enlightenment join forces for three concerts exploring the finest musical remixes from the baroque to the present day at Kings Place.
